The statement that applies to plants is: "The ability of most cells to differentiate remains throughout the life of the organism."

In plants, most cells retain the ability to differentiate throughout their life. This is unlike many animals, where the ability of cells to differentiate is often lost during development. This characteristic allows plants to continuously grow and produce new organs such as leaves, stems, and flowers throughout their life.
